<\/span>When did the Blackout challenge start?<\/span><\/h3>\nThe blackout challenge is not the latest one you think. It has existed since 2008 as a choking game, but it’s now getting viral on TikTok again in 2021 and reaching people in a different mode. Experts warn young users not to try this wrong TikTok trend. It mainly contributes to more than 80 deaths, per a study conveyed by the Centre for Disease Control and Prevention.<\/p>\n
Even the TikTok spokesperson told the public that “this offensive challenge” which people come to know about from sources other than the TikTok long predates our platform, and it’s never been a TikTok trend. Further stated, we remain watchful in our commitment to user safety and would instantly remove related content if found.”<\/p>\n
<\/span>Signs that your kid is involved in TikTok Blackout Challenge<\/span><\/h3>\nHere are a few signs explaining that kids are involved in this disturbing viral trend.<\/p>\n
Discussion of the game\u00a0\u2013 including other terms used, such as “pass\u2013out game” or “space monkey.”<\/p>\n
Bloodshot eyes<\/p>\n
Marks on the neck<\/p>\n
Severe headaches<\/p>\n
Disorientation after spending time alone<\/p>\n
Ropes, scarves, and belts tied to the furniture, doorknobs, or found knotted on the floor.<\/p>\n
<\/span>What TikTok team has said?<\/span><\/h3>\nTikTok faced controversy and blaming statements for several deaths so far. Some families have also sued video-sharing app TikTok over the claims that the TikTok algorithm intentionally and repeatedly promotes the filming of other people performing the blackout challenge.<\/p>\n
In response to most of the filed complaints, TikTok claimed in Washington Post that it had blocked all users searching for the blackout challenge. The user sees one of its warnings on their screens saying that” some online challenges can be dangerous, upsetting or fabricated, and get a page link in the app about assessing challenges and warning.<\/p>\n
